Pulp then, ridiculous now.
The only reasons to read this book are historical and sociological. It was written as popular adventure in an era that accepted European imperialism. It is rife with racism, nationalism, sexism, and has little relation to the realities of Africa or its people or wildlife. Burroughs never saw Africa, so much is invented out of whole cloth.As a window into the thinking of early 20th century Brits, as an example of how risque and violent adventure stories could be in that era, and as a check on the authenticity of the many movies which followed, it might be worth reading this book. Otherwise, as a story, as literature, as good writing, or as a portrayal of Africa, it is singularly lacking..The one worthwhile tidbit is that when searching for the most remote backwater of America in which to put his hero to the test once more, Burroughs chose - Northern Wisconsin!
